I am currently trying to copy the container from a live page to my local page. Unfortunately, I always get this error:
(Elementor tutorial )
Make sure that both pages are updated to the latest version of Elementor and have the functions for the copied element activated before you try again.
Of course I have already checked whether the Elementor settings on both sides are identical. I also contacted Elementor support, but they referred me to local support. They also sent me this link . But I don’t think it will help me because I don’t get any console errors and I’m not using Apache but an nginx server.

I’m not sure if this is valid or not but are both sites using the same versions of WP/PHP/MySQL? Are they both using the same theme?
I just noticed there are some differences:
Site 1 (live site) :
Operating System: Linux*
Software: Apache*
MySQL version: MySQL Community Server - GPL v8.0.36*
PHP Version: 8.3.8*
Site 2 (local site) :
Operating System: WINNT*
Software: nginx/1.16.0*
MySQL version: MySQL Community Server - GPL v8.0.16*
PHP Version: 8.1.23*
What would you recommend, update the PHP/MySQL version from site 2(local site) ?
1 Like
Using the same PHP version actually solved the problem.
